THE BARN GALLERY, WOODLAND. Join YoloArts & Oke Jr for a series of POL workshops. Students will have a chance to research & select poems from the POL Anthology, work on recitation, stage presence & understanding as they prepare to compete in Yolo County's annual Poetry Out Loud competition. Winner of the county competition will advance to the State Finals. 4:30p–6p. Free
